Accountant
Job Description
Universal Life is seeking to recruit an Accountant to join the Finance Department, at the Company’s Head Offices in Nicosia. The selected candidate will report to the Company’s Chief Accountant and will be involved in all areas of Accounting Operations.
Main Responsibilities
Accounting & Operational Oversight
Review and verify accounting entries related to premiums, claims, reinsurance, commissions, and investments.
Ensure that reconciliations of technical and non-technical accounts are completed timely and are of high quality.
Ensure accurate journal entries and compliance with the company’s accounting policies and regulatory framework.
Month-End and Year-End Procedures
Lead monthly and annual financial closings, ensuring completeness and timeliness of internal and external reporting.
Prepare schedules and supporting documentation for internal and external audits, including Solvency II-related data.
Tax & Regulatory Compliance
Prepare and submit VAT returns, tax computations, and IR4, ensuring full compliance with local tax laws applicable to insurance companies.
Monitor developments in tax and regulatory changes and assess their impact on the organization.
Audit & Internal Controls
Serve as a key point of contact for statutory, tax, regulatory and internal audits.
Strengthen internal controls and support the implementation of best practices in financial risk management.
Cross-Functional Collaboration
Collaborate with other departments and functions to ensure smooth and accurate financial integration.
Liaise with IT teams to support data accuracy and automation initiatives.
Process Optimization & Digital Transformation
Participate in the automation of accounting and reporting processes (e.g. IFRS 17 tools, SAP enhancements).
Identify areas for increased efficiency and reduced operational risk.
Insurance Finance & IFRS Reporting
Assist in the preparation of financial statements in accordance with IFRSs.
Support the Chief Accountant in regulatory reporting to the Superintendent of Insurance and other authorities.
Other
Take on other relevant responsibilities as deemed appropriate by the Chief Accountant.
Requirements
A University degree (or equivalent) in Accounting, Finance or related field.
ACA / ACCA (or equivalent) professional qualification will be considered an advantage.
At least 3 years of experience, ideally with experience in insurance accounting or a Big 4 audit portfolio focused on insurance clients.
Hands-on experience with accounting systems. Knowledge of SAP or IFRS 17 software will be considered an advantage.
In-depth knowledge of IFRSs, particularly IFRS 17, IFRS 9, and Solvency II reporting will be considered an advantage.
Strong understanding of Cyprus tax legislation, with particular focus on the insurance industry.
Advanced Excel skills and proficiency in Microsoft Office.
Excellent command of the Greek and English languages (verbal and written).
Strong attention to detail and a high level of accuracy.
Excellent time management and problem-solving skills.
Ability to work under pressure and meet tight deadlines.
Strong interpersonal skills and a collaborative, team-oriented mindset.
Ability to influence and work with other teams across the organisation to achieve objectives.

Who we are
Universal Life was the first insurance company founded in Cyprus after the enactment of the local insurance legislation in 1970 with the vision to assist in the development of the life insurance industry on the island. Having completed five decades of contribution to the Cypriot economy and its society in general, Universal Life has made its name synonymous with life and health insurance in Cyprus. Today, Universal Life is one of the largest insurance companies in Cyprus, possessing a special place in Cyprus services sector.
